About the Art:
I Loved the Light that he who looks at it doesn’t go Blind or Petrified but he lives Forever.
Bathed in shadows, the stoic face of Medusa emerges, fragmented by Frank Moth’s gilded tears that streak through the darkness, symbolizing a bridge between antiquity and the digital age. This artwork beautifully merges the grandeur of the Renaissance with the edginess of modern design, creating a dialogue between the marble’s coldness and the warmth of the gold.
It’s a thought-provoking visual feast that captures the tension between the enduring and the ephemeral.
